[wp-trac] [WordPress Trac] #23550: Twenty Thirteen: add RTL support

WordPress Trac noreply at wordpress.org
Sun Mar 3 19:25:13 UTC 2013


#23550: Twenty Thirteen: add RTL support
---------------------------+------------------
 Reporter:  lancewillett   |       Owner:
     Type:  defect (bug)   |      Status:  new
 Priority:  normal         |   Milestone:  3.6
Component:  Bundled Theme  |     Version:
 Severity:  normal         |  Resolution:
 Keywords:  has-patch      |
---------------------------+------------------
Changes (by maor):

 * cc: maorhaz@… (added)


Comment:

 I know it might be a bit too early at this point, but I was going to use
 Twenty Thirteen on my blog anyway, so I worked a bit on the RTL
 stylesheet.

 [attachment:23550.2.diff​] extends Drew's initial patch. There's still
 room for improvement, but I have covered most of the RTL rules (incl.
 responsive design). As you may notice, I've also changed the
 `functions.js` file, since the widgets area in the footer is controlled
 from there (Twenty Thirteen is using jQuery Masonry, which does not enable
 RTL support by default but instead, offers a manual setting/switch for RTL
 pages - "`isRTL`").

 Here's a quick snapshot of how it looks after [attachment:23550.2.diff​]
 is applied.
 http://i.imgur.com/eTcMOJb.png

-- 
Ticket URL: <http://core.trac.wordpress.org/ticket/23550#comment:2>
WordPress Trac <http://core.trac.wordpress.org/>
WordPress blogging software


More information about the wp-trac mailing list